Yes, let us start from the Benin River Port at Gelegele in Ovia North-East Local Government Area. Groundbreaking of the project took place in 2017.
But all the PDP administration is doing today is audio talk of its determination to deliver the port. No actionable; sincere timeline is fixed for date of completion of the project.
For instance, in 2021 while announcing his utopian and futuristic VISION 2050 to a visiting United Nations Country Team to Edo State, Obaseki said: "We must build the Benin River Port to lighten up to 30 percent of the cargo from Tin Can and Apapa Ports".( Nigerian Observer/July 29, 2021)

Without bothering about the emotional trauma Edo people have over this slow project, the insensitive PDP government went into an MOU arrangement in 2021 with a private conglomerate to build an INLAND DRY PORT in Ikpoba- Okha Local Government Area.
Here is what Obaseki told Edo people about this project: "This is a viable and landmark project. The role of government is to create a peaceful atmosphere and enabling environment for business to thrive in the state.
"The dry port on completion will take over 200,000 containers at any time. It will aggregate and export about 56 million kilograms of agricultural products monthly; generate N70m monthly as revenue for Edo State Government; and create 30,000 jobs in the next three years." (Nigerian Observer./February 23, 2021)
